Applications of the preview control method to the optimal problem for linear continuous-time stochastic systems with time-delay

摘要

This paper discusses the optimal control problem for a class of linear continuous-time stochastic systems with time-delay based on the preview control method. In the design procedure, the time-delay terms are formally eliminated and the augmented error system method is used. The optimal controller of the time-delay stochastic system is obtained based on dynamic programming principle. In the previous approaches, the preview control method is applied to continuous-time deterministic system. Consequently, compared with the existing results, the main contributions of this paper are: (1) the conclusion of the non-singular transformation is improved and (2) the conclusion in deterministic system is extended by using the methods of designing an assistant system and introducing an integrator when building the stochastic augmented error system. The optimal tracking of the stochastic system with time-delay is realized by solving the optimal regulation problem of the stochastic augmented error system. The simulation shows the effectiveness of the controller designed in this paper.
